Let's create a snapshot test for a small intro component with a few views and text components and some styles: Chai test fail with "Unexpected import token" Follow. it's not plain JavaScript. when your code or its dependencies use non-standard JavaScript syntax, or when Jest is not configured to support such syntax.
Unit-Test errors: SyntaxError: Unexpected token export By default, if Jest sees a Babel config, it will use that to transform….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g. Conclusion. Angular component Importing TypeScript class causing jest failure. Create .babelrc configuration file. It seems that Jest is missing the babel configuration in my package.json and the test suite is failing with 'Unexpected Token Import'. 此时问题变成:. React is a Javascript framework growing in popularity by the day. Setting the type property to module in the package.json file of your project allows you to use ES6 modules in your Node.js application. I am getting below errow: Test suite failed to run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g.
Jest - Unexpected token import : codehunter Coming from v23.10? it's not plain JavaScript.
How I resolved issues while setting up Jest and Enzyme in a React app ... 配置完后发现jest引用的文件使用import是没报错了,但是jest内引用的包在node_modules里使用了es6语法,仍然报错。. By default, if Jest sees a Babel config, it will use that to transform your files, ignoring "node_modules". (<your-package-goes-here>)/)'", 5. paulosullivan22. Most of the differences are explained in Node's documentation, but in addition to the things mentioned there, Jest injects a special variable into all executed files - the jest object. Hi, I'm just learning JavaScript on CodeCademy and I'm confused. Our website collects the most common questions and it give's answers for developers to those questions. Angular component Importing TypeScript class causing jest failure.
SyntaxError: Unexpected token export using jest - Fantas…hit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g. The cookie is used to store the user consent for the cookies in the category "Analytics". Then Jest will transform the modules into something it can use. Probably it was caused by hurrying up writing a component and autocompleting an import with an IDE help. it's not plain JavaScript. Here is one of the most popular question which is related to testing with jest for repo setup with create-react-app as I've seen in stackoverflow community. Cookie Duration Description; cookielawinfo-checbox-analytics: 11 months: This cookie is set by GDPR Cookie Consent plugin. Close. For Webpack it is fine because it passes all the code through Babel, links all dependencies, and transpile them to vanilla js which in Jest's case isn't. I still have doubts about, drop me a comment, and let's discuss it :) Posted by 5 minutes ago. it's not plain JavaScript. it 's not plain JavaScript. Here is one of the most popular question which is related to testing with jest for repo setup with create-react-app as I've seen in stackoverflow community.
Fix "Jest encountered an unexpected token" with "create-react-app" when your code or its dependencies use non-standard JavaScript syntax, or when Jest is not configured to support such syntax. By default, if Jest sees a Babel config, it will use that to transform your files, ignoring "node_modules". class MyClass1 { } class MyClass2 { } module.exports = { MyClass1, MyClass2 } View another examples Add Own solution. The best website to find answers to your reactjs questions. The "Unexpected token ." message probably comes because the first line of the file it is choking on is a CSS class declaration, i.e. Fix "Jest encountered an unexpected token" with "create-react-app" # jest # testing # react # javascript. Test suite failed to run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g.
Vue Data table and jest error? unexpected Token - JavaScript - The ... PASS test/jesttest.spec.js (5.243s) Console console.log test/jesttest.spec.js:18 red FAIL test/ExitUserCompany.spec.js Test suite failed to run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g.
import.meta - JavaScript | MDN - Mozilla Configuring Jest · Jest Support all available TypeScript features including type checking. Easy to Use. it's not plain JavaScript. Check out our v23.10 to latest version migration guide. when your code or its dependencies use non-standard JavaScript syntax, or when Jest is not configured to support such syntax. .
How to fix error '"Unexpected token *" on import statement' with Jest ...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g.
Jest Unexpected Token a.k.a. won't transpile error - Dylan Pierce This is necessary because babel-jest relies on a traditional Babel config file, not webpack.
React: Import CSS - Unexpected Token - DPS Computing Hi guys, I have a project which uses mocha chai unit tests.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g.
ts-jest: Unexpected token export with Lodash | gitmotion.com SyntaxError: Cannot use import statement outside a module (phpStorm/Js ... Updated March 1, 2021. Of course "export" is a valid syntax, however, most probably some issues which occur during compilation are causing a domino effect which at points to the different place from where the root cause lays. Please keep in mind that up until a week ago, this configuration was working successfully in several projects, so I am assuming it's a regression and figured I should report it.
Jest encountered an unexpected token - "import - GitHub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g.
Jest and ESM: Cannot use import statement outside a module Here are my babel presets: To fix the 'SyntaxError: Cannot use import statement outside a module' with Jest, we need to tell Jest to transpile ES6 modules before we can use them.
Jest: Error: SyntaxError: Cannot use import statement outside a module Jest encountered an unexpected token This usually means that you are trying to import a file which Jest cannot parse, e.g. I use webstorm 2017.2.3 payed license.
Jest encountered an unexpected token - Modeler - Forum - bpmn.io Unexpected token 'export'. Several Jest presets to let you start quickly with testing.
Solved ts jest Jest encountered an unexpected token Jest throwing `SyntaxError: Unexpected token import` on new Vue CLI
Aude Lagarde, Maire De Drancy,
Comment Tester Un Fil électrique Avec Un Multimètre,
Articles J